package org.compass.core.mapping.osem.builder;
import org.compass.core.Property;
import org.compass.core.converter.Converter;
import org.compass.core.converter.mapping.ResourcePropertyConverter;
import org.compass.core.mapping.osem.ClassDynamicPropertyMapping;
/**
* Specifies a searchable dynamic property on property or field of the Searchable class.
*
* <p>Dynamic property is a proeprty where the Resource Property name is dynamic in addition to the value itself.
*
* <p>The annotation can be placed on a custom type (or an array / collection of it). When used on a custom type,
* the field/property of the custom type for the dynamic name, and the field/property of the custom type for the dynamic value
* should be explciitly set using {@link #nameProperty(String)} and {@link #valueProperty(String)}. Another option, instead of setting
* them, is by using {@link org.compass.annotations.SearchableDynamicName} on the custom type field/property and
* {@link org.compass.annotations.SearchableDynamicValue} on the custom type field/property.
*
* <p>The annotation can also be placed on a {@link java.util.Map} type, where its key will act as the Resource property
* name and its value will act as the Resource property value. The Map value can also be an array or collection. It is
* best to use generics when defining the Map.
*
* <p>When annotating a Map, the {@link #nameProperty(String)} or {@link #valueConverter(String)} (or their respective annotation)
* can also be used in case the Map key and/or Map value are custom types.
*
* <p>The format for the name can be set using {@link #nameFormat(String)} and the format for the value can be set using
* {@link #valueFormat(String)}.
*
* @author kimchy
* @see org.compass.core.mapping.osem.builder.OSEM#metadata(String)
* @see org.compass.core.mapping.osem.builder.SearchableMappingBuilder#add(SearchableDynamicPropertyMappingBuilder)
*/
public class SearchableDynamicPropertyMappingBuilder {
final ClassDynamicPropertyMapping mapping;
public SearchableDynamicPropertyMappingBuilder(String name) {
mapping = new ClassDynamicPropertyMapping();
mapping.setName(name);
mapping.setPropertyName(name);
mapping.setOverrideByName(true);
}
